IBPS Clerk 8 December Shift 2 Prelims Exam Analysis: What was the difficulty level?
As per the exam syllabus and pattern for IBPS Clerk Examination, there were 100 questions in total. Each question carried 1 mark and the total time to solve the paper was 60 minutes.
Now the question is: What was the difficulty level of IBPS Clerk Shift 2 Exam?
Answer: Easy to Moderate!

IBPS Clerk 8 December Shift 2 Exam: Quantitative Aptitude
- Level of Difficulty: Easy-Moderate
- Good Attempts: 22-24
- Optimal Time: 20 Minutes
Our first part of IBPS Clerk Exam Analysis and Review starts with Quant Section, which was Easy – Moderate and filled with a bunch of calculative simplifications. The topic-wise review and distribution are as follows:
Name of the Topic | No. of Questions | Level of Difficulty |
Data Interpretation | 10 | Easy – Moderate |
Number Series | 5 | Easy |
Simplification | 10 | Easy-Moderate |
Miscellaneous (Ages, Time and Work, Mixtures & Alligation, Boats & Streams etc.) | 10 | Moderate |
Miscellaneous topic included the questions on Ages, Time and Work, Mixtures & Alligation, Boats & Streams etc. Other topics were little calculative.
IBPS Clerk 8 December Shift 2 Exam: Reasoning Ability Section
- Level of Difficulty: Easy-Moderate
- Good Attempts: 26-28
- Optimal Time: 20 Minutes
Moving to our next section, Reasoning Ability questions in today’s IBPS Clerk Exam Analysis had a bit of Easy – Moderate Difficulty Level. The topic-wise review and distribution are as follows:
Name of the Topic | No. of Questions | Level of Difficulty |
Sitting Arrangements & Puzzles | 20 | Easy |
Blood Relations | 2 | Easy-Moderate |
Alphabet Series | 3 | Easy-Moderate |
Inequality | 3-4 | Easy |
Syllogism | 3-4 | Easy |
Candidates found today’s reasoning section to be more attemptable. A good attempt in this section would be 26-28 questions.
IBPS Clerk 8 December Shift 2 Exam: English Section
- Level of Difficulty: Easy-Moderate
- Good Attempts: 26-28
- Optimal Time: 20 Minutes
This section was Easy-Moderate. This year, IBPS Clerk Prelims 2018 posed a major threat to aspirants who relied heavily upon scoring well in English Section. First, most scoring topics like Cloze Test were nowhere to be found and Fillers & Words with Similar Meaning questions were challenging to solve.
Name of the Topic | No. of Questions | Level of Difficulty |
Spot the correct one | 8-10 | Moderate |
Reading Comprehension | 5 – 7 | Easy- Moderate |
Single Filers | 5 | Moderate |
Words usage | 3-4 | Moderate |
Match the following | 5 | Moderate |
Sentence Rearrangement | 5 | Easy – Moderate |
